Boot fitting for recreational skiing entails choosing and customizing ski boots to ensure comfort, help, and performance on the slopes. A proper fit enhances skier performance and reduces the chance of damage.
How do I know if my ski boots fit properly?
Properly fitting ski boots should really feel snug however not painfully tight. Your heel should keep in place whenever you flex forward, and your toes ought to just barely touch the entrance. A professional boot fitter may help assess this.

What ought to I look for when choosing ski boots?
Consider your snowboarding capability, foot shape, and style. Look for a flex rating that matches your skill stage and choose between narrow, medium, or wide widths to accommodate your foot shape.

Can I modify my ski boots after purchase?
Yes, ski boots can often be modified post-purchase. Many boot fitters offer companies like heat molding, custom footbeds, or shell changes to enhance fit and comfort.

What if my feet get chilly whereas skiing?
Cold feet can often be alleviated by guaranteeing proper fit and insulation. A boot fitter can advise on appropriate liners and socks. Additionally, heated insoles may be helpful for severe cold situations.

What are some frequent errors people make when fitting ski boots?

Common mistakes embody choosing the incorrect measurement, ignoring foot shape, or not considering snowboarding type. Many also overlook the importance of carrying applicable socks during fitting, which might significantly impact fit and comfort.
